Taylor Dawson of Collinsville on the podium after winning her weight class at the Peoria (Richwoods) Sectional. Photo provided by Kahok Athletics
By Mark Jurgena
The Collinsville girls wrestling team competed in the Peoria (Richwoods) Sectional tournament this weekend.
Five members of the squad competed in the 2nd annual IHSA state series.
“These girls have made incredible progress this season on the mat,” said CHS assistant wrestling coach Adam Gillespie. “It’s most of their first season wrestling at this level of competition. I think they’re all ready to come back this off-season and work towards winning their sectional bracket!”
Sophomore Taylor Dawson raised her record to 30-4 (35-12 including matches with the boys team) this year by beating four opponents to win the 130-pound title.
“Taylor has worked towards this point in the year all season and she knows that the real challenge is just beginning,” said Gillespie. “I think she’s excited to be in a position to beat her finish at the tournament last year.”
Last season, Dawson fell in the state championship bout of the 125-pound class.
This season she began her tournament with a 22-6 tech fall over Jenna Tuxhorn of Chatham (Glenwood) in her first bout.
Next, she pinned Aliyah Brooks of Jerseyville at the 1:55 mark of the contest.
In the semifinals, Dawson pinned Jaylah Dalton of Pekin in 55 seconds to move to the title bout.
Finally, in the championship, she defeated Karen Canchola of Morton via a 5-4 decision. Canchola fell to 22-5 on the season.
Kahoks Emma Ford at 115 pounds and Tashieya Taylor at 155 pounds both went 2-2 at the sectional.
Ford decisioned Alie Chong of Edwardsville 11-7 in her first match before she was pinned by Jasmine Brown of Auburn at the 3:00 mark.
In the Consolation bracket, she pinned Nita Sims from Springfield (Southeast) at the 1:55 mark.
In her last match, she was decisioned 3-0 by Samantha Lauer of Deer Creek (Mackinaw).
Ford finished her season at 16-12.
Taylor began her postseason with a pin in 1:38 over Mackenzie Myers of Robinson.
In her second match, she was pinned in 47 seconds by the defending state champion in the 155-pound class, Lexi Ritchie of Tolono (Unity).
Ritchie is currently ranked 21st in the nation according to USA Wrestling.
In Taylor’s third match, she pinned Melissa Bell of Hillsboro by a pin at the 1:21 mark.
Finally, she was pinned by Elanna Hickman of Alton at 3:07.
Taylor finished the season at 10-15.
Alanni Torres won her first match at 140 pounds against Saryah Dixon of Mt. Vernon via pinfall at 4:00 before falling in her final two matches.
Hannah Jones completed her tournament with an 11-8 mark for the year.
Upcoming Schedule
Dawson will compete in the State Finals on Feb. 24-25 at Grossinger Motors Arena in Bloomington
